#628895 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#628895 is composed of 38.4% red, 53.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 8.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 195.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.6% and a lightness of 48.4%. #628895 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00112b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#628895 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#628895 has RGB values of R:98, G:136,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6457493.

Shades and Tints of #628895
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050607 is the darkest color, while #fafb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#628895
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757f82 is the less saturated color, while #03b7f4 is the most saturated one.
